  • Description
    The CREKA pentapeptide (Cys-Arg-Glu-Lys-Ala) was identified through in vivo phage display. It exhibits high affinity for fibrin-fibronectin complexes prevalent in pathological microenvironments. The cysteine residue enables covalent conjugation to nanocarriers such as liposomes and micelles, while its balanced charge distribution enhances target binding specificity. CREKA-modified nanoprobes demonstrate superior site retention and accumulation, enabling precision imaging applications including tumor stroma detection and vascular visualization. Further applications leverage its low immunogenicity for designing targeted molecular delivery systems in biomarker studies and biomedical engineering.

  • About TFA salt

    Trifluoroacetic acid (TFA) is a common counterion from the purification process using High-Performance Liquid Chromatography (HPLC). The presence of TFA can affect the peptide's net weight, appearance, and solubility.

    Impact on Net Weight: The TFA salt contributes to the total mass of the product. In most cases, the peptide content constitutes >80% of the total weight, with TFA accounting for the remainder.

    Solubility: TFA salts generally enhance the solubility of peptides in aqueous solutions.

    In Biological Assays: For most standard in vitro assays, the residual TFA levels do not cause interference. However, for highly sensitive cellular or biochemical studies, please be aware of its presence.
